The survey reveals some interesting insights into the satisfaction levels of road users in the South East. Overall, there's been a notable improvement, with a sharp rise in satisfaction regarding roadworks management. This is a positive step forward, indicating that efforts to minimize disruptions are paying off.
Road Surface and Safety
When it comes to the road surface, the South East aligns with the national average, which is encouraging. However, it's the feeling of safety that stands out as a key factor. With an 81% rating, it's clear that road users in this region feel secure on their journeys. This aspect is often overlooked but is crucial for a positive driving experience.
